Common Renovation Projects and Their Challenges

Each industrial renovation project has its own hurdles. Professional Industrial Renovation Experts tailor their strategy based on the facility’s purpose and structure. Below are some common scenarios professionals address regularly:

  1. Electrical system overhauls: Factories often outgrow outdated electrical panels. Upgrading without disrupting operations demands careful coordination and temporary backup systems.
  2. Structural reinforcements: Old buildings may not support modern HVAC or robotic systems. Experts evaluate load-bearing walls and roof trusses before any installations.
  3. Floorplan reconfiguration: Warehouses might need better layouts for safety or efficiency. Moving walls, expanding storage, or adding mezzanines requires precision engineering to meet codes.

For instance, retrofitting a warehouse in Tulsa for increased ceiling height involved phased demolition, relocation of lighting grids, and new ventilation systems — all without disrupting inventory access.

How Professional Industrial Renovation Experts Ensure Safety

Safety is central to any successful renovation. Employers must protect workers, clients, and contractors throughout the process. Professional Industrial Renovation Experts build safety into every stage.

Key elements of their approach include:

  • Developing comprehensive safety plans approved by engineering consultants
  • Installing temporary barriers and signage to restrict hazardous zones
  • Managing environmental disruptions such as asbestos or chemical exposure

For example, during the renovation of a 40-year-old paint production facility, experts contained toxic dust zones with industrial air scrubbers and sealed plastic barriers. As a result, operations continued during off-hours, and no contamination incidents occurred.

Not every contractor is right for your industrial job. It’s essential to investigate qualifications and past projects before selecting a team. Here’s what to verify when evaluating candidates:

  • Licensing and insurance: Confirm they carry the appropriate state and federal certifications for industrial projects.
  • Project portfolio: Review past renovations with similar scope, materials, and industry-specific demands.
  • References and reviews: Contact previous clients to assess reliability, communication, and deliverables.

It’s also a great idea to meet face-to-face and review initial proposals. A true expert will bring specific ideas and propose feasible timelines without overpromising.
